Abu Dhabi Chamber Launches "Procurement Connect" to Empower SMEs
To bolster the growth of small and medium-sized enterprises, the Abu Dhabi Chamber of Commerce and Industry has officially launched "Procurement Connect." This strategic initiative is designed to bridge the gap between local businesses and the emirateâs leading organizations by providing clearer visibility into upcoming supply chain requirements and procurement plans. By fostering direct communication between industry giants and private sector firms, the Chamber aims to help SMEs enhance their competitiveness and better align their services with the future demands of Abu Dhabiâs evolving market.
During the launch forum, major industry players like Etihad Airways, e& UAE, and Adnoc shared vital insights into their long-term procurement priorities and supplier expectations. For instance, e& UAE highlighted its focus on digital transformation and AI-driven infrastructure, while Adnoc showcased the continued success of its In-Country Value (ICV) program, which has contributed hundreds of billions of dirhams to the local economy. These industry leaders are increasingly prioritizing local partnerships, creating a clear pathway for smaller companies to secure high-value contracts and contribute to the nationâs industrial resilience and economic vision.
